I love to set up a meet & greet prior to the first pet sitting with new clients. This is where I'll ask all the important questions about your pets needs and care instructions. These will vary depending on the service. But here are some things that I find helpful to prepare for your pet sitting. -Having a paper copy of care instructions in the home is great. I have an easy but comprehensive form you can fill out if needed. -Have a good emergency plan in advance. Emergencies almost never happen, but on that rare chance we want to be swift and decisive should the unforeseen occur. If you are going to be hard to reach, it helps to alert your vet that you have a sitter so you can pre-authorize them in case of an emergency. Its also great to have transport items easily accessible should they need a vet visit, leashes / harness / crate / cat carrier, etc.
